Output 421fb6ab95b2f9730030714a8dcc0f361f97c6e90b920b6edd90dd60b7958315:1

value
2320000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13a53a71cf6343b4614fa13aee99f07b0f5ed055 OP_EQUAL
address
33UthTAqRT4czwoJbmo1s9hV6PAojZfJt5
transaction
421fb6ab95b2f9730030714a8dcc0f361f97c6e90b920b6edd90dd60b7958315
spent
true